USA Flag Waffles Recipe

Yield: 4 Servings
Prep Time: 10 minutes

Are you going to be celebrating the birth of our great country with a bang? We found a great way to celebrate the USA with these fun and tasty Flag Waffles.

Ingredients

  • Waffles (homemade or store-bought)
  • Whipped Cream Cheese
  • Fresh strawberries, sliced diagonally
  • Fresh blueberries
  • Bananas, sliced length-wise and then sliced in half

Instructions

  1. Spread a thin layer of whipped cream cheese on a waffle.
  2. Place a single layer of blueberries along the entire outer edge of the waffle.
  3. Add additional blueberries to the upper left corner of the waffle to resemble the stars of the flag.
  4. Alternate strawberry and banana slices to make the stripes of the flag, the cream cheese will hold the fruit pieces in place.
  5. Repeat step 5 all of the way down the waffle.
  6. ENJOY!

Homemade Waffles Recipe

Yield: 4 Waffles
Prep Time: 10 minutes
Cook Time: 10 minutes
Total Time: 20 minutes

This is an easy recipe for homemade waffles that you can use for a variety of recipes like breakfast, brunch, or even dinners!

Ingredients

  • 1 1/3 cups all-purpose flour
  • 1 Tablespoon baking powder
  • 1/2 teaspoon salt
  • 1 T granulated sugar
  • 2 eggs, separated
  • 1/2 cup unsalted butter, melted
  • 1 3/4 cups whole milk

Instructions

  1. Add all of the dry ingredients in a large mixing bowl and whisk until blended.
  2. Separate both eggs, adding the yolks to the dry ingredient mixture and placing the whites in a separate small mixing bowl.
  3. Beat the whites until stiff peaks form, set aside.
  4. And the milk and melted butter to the dry ingredient mixture and blend well.
  5. Fold the stiff egg whites into the dry ingredient mixture.
  6. Pour waffle batter into a hot waffle iron and bake.
  7. Remove hot waffle from waffle iron and immediately place on plate to cool.
